207 * gboolean value_validate (GParamSpec *pspec,
209 * modify value contents in the least destructive way, so
210 * that it complies with pspec's requirements (i.e.
211 * according to minimum/maximum ranges etc...). return
212 * whether modification was necessary.
214 * gint values_cmp (GParamSpec *pspec,
215 * const GValue *value1,
216 * const GValue *value2):
217 * return value1 - value2, i.e. (-1) if value1 < value2,
218 * (+1) if value1 > value2, and (0) otherwise (equality)
